Myth 3: Fat comes back somewhere else This misconception has teeth since it consists of a bit of opportunity. Below's how fat biology works. After teenage years, the majority of people keep a relatively set variety of fat cells. Gain and loss reflect fat cells swelling or reducing, not mass duplication, besides considerable weight changes or specific medications. When you remove or ruin fat cells in a dealt with zone, those cells are gone for good. That area's ability for storage decreases. You can still gain weight, yet the circulation pattern changes based upon the continuing to be cells throughout your body. People assume the fat "moved" to their arms or back due to the fact that those locations look fuller after a large holiday season. More probable, the cured location expanded less about anywhere else, so your eye sees comparison. I've seen this play out across years. Patients that preserve steady routines keep a better silhouette without odd bulges appearing in arbitrary locations. Those who quit relocating, rest improperly, or increase calories can restore quantity, just in a different way distributed. The takeaway is not be afraid, it's stewardship. Not every millimeter is worth the rate and the process. Myth 6: All devices do the same thing If it hums, heats, cools down, or pulses, it must melt fat, ideal? Not rather. Instruments come under a few family members that assault different targets. Cryolipolysis uses controlled cooling to induce apoptosis in fat cells. It's ideal for pinchable pockets, like lower abdominal area or flanks, and struggles with very fibrous areas or very little subcutaneous density. Radiofrequency gadgets create heat that can both hurt fat cells at deeper settings and boost collagen in the dermis. Ultrasound can focus energy to interrupt fat more selectively. Electromagnetic stimulation agreements muscular tissues at strengths you can't accomplish voluntarily, which can develop a small amount of muscle and tighten up the superior location. Then there are lasers with details wavelengths that soften fat cell membranes without significant thermal injury, in some cases coupled with suction and massage to boost lymphatic flow. Even within a category, settings, handpiece geometry, and operator technique adjustment results. I've seen two centers with the very same version generate really different outcomes due to the fact that one mapped the makeup and layered passes tactically while the other tried to cover the whole abdominal area in one session. Ask what the device targets, why it's matched to your cells, and the amount of sessions your supplier typically does for situations like yours. It's since the expectation was a filter, not anatomy. Risks that deserve airtime Complications are unusual yet not mythical. Paradoxical adipose hyperplasia, a condition where fat expands in the treated area after cryolipolysis, takes place in a tiny portion of cases, typically cited around tenths of a percent. It's more common in guys and in specific structural websites. It needs medical adjustment, which is bothersome and expensive, but fixable in seasoned hands. Contour abnormalities after lipo are the other elephant. They take place when excessive fat is taken from one subzone, when skin recoil is overestimated, or when cannula passes are irregular. Revision is feasible but laborious, involving fat grafting, subcision, or added liposuction surgery to mix airplanes. Choosing a surgeon with a musician's eye and a conventional viewpoint minimizes this danger far more than picking a stylish cannula or a headline technique. Burns from energy-based devices are uncommon when procedures are complied with, yet anyone can make a mistake. That's why grounding pads, temperature level tracking, and handpiece motion patterns issue. Tools doesn't make up for a distracted operator. The surgical range: what changes fast, what takes months Surgery feels decisive permanently factor. You go to sleep with one shape and wake up with one more, wrapped in compression yet certainly altered. Early days bring dramatization. Swelling, pins and needles, drainage, sleep in a recliner chair, a new relationship with your washroom range. Then the tempo slows down. Fibrosis softens. Incisions grow. Nerves wake up. Skin discovers its brand-new job. Liposuction: quickly disclose, slow refinement Most people see a visible change as quickly as the very first cover comes off. The trick is not to puzzle "I can see the change" with "my outcome is done." Common arc: First week: swelling peaks around day three to five. Bruising differs however typically fades by day 10 to fourteen. You can walk the same day and return to non-strenuous job after three to five days for little areas, 7 to 10 for larger situations. Pain seems like a deep health club ache. Weeks two to 4: form looks irregular at times. Fluid shifts and early mark cells make surfaces feel lumpy or "ropey." This daunts meticulous individualities. Massage and compression smooth this phase. Months 2 to 3: refinement ends up being noticeable. Edges develop at the waistline and thighs. Feeling numb decreases yet can linger in patches. Months four to 6: result. A lot of recurring rigidity, firmness, and subtle swelling fade. At six months, we call it main unless you had very large-volume job, which can choose up to nine months. Timelines run much longer for areas with looser skin, like the inner upper legs or arms, since the skin's recoil issues as high as fat removal. If your skin flexibility is borderline, the "done" factor is much less regarding time and more regarding whether your skin can adjust. Sometimes we intend presented therapies: lipo initially, after that a tiny excision if laxity persists. Tummy tuck: remarkable adjustment, disciplined recovery Abdominoplasty reorganizes tissue, not just volume. We move and tighten up muscle mass, get rid of excess skin, and frequently match it with liposuction surgery. That combination delivers a flat abdominal wall surface and a clean waist, however it likewise asks for patience. Days one to three: stroll bent at the hips to shield the laceration. Drainpipes prevail for traditional methods, less so with drainless techniques that utilize even more inner quilting. Pain is convenient with medication yet spikes with coughing, chuckling, and sudden actions. A reclining chair is your finest friend. Weeks one to two: drains pipes generally appeared by day 5 to ten if you have them. Strolling upright returns gradually. That initial shower where you see your new abdominal areas can be emotional, swelling and all. Weeks 3 to 6: you move freely, though raising heavy things still yanks. Feeling numb between the stomach button and reduced incision is regular. Compression helps contour and comfort. Desk job is reasonable by two weeks for many, 3 if your job draws you out of a chair. Months three to 6: this is the sweet place when the mark softens, swelling in the lower abdomen discolors, and the waist reduces a tidy contour in garments. Athletes often resume complete activity by 8 to 10 weeks, with core-heavy work programmed thoughtfully. Months six to twelve: scars clear up. If you scar red, anticipate that color for numerous months before it soothes. Silicone treatment, sunlight defense, and time issue greater than any kind of "wonder" cream. If you listen to someone say their abdominoplasty result took a year, they are speaking about mark maturation and the last couple of millimeters of swell. The monotony and boosted position get here early, normally by six to eight weeks. Arm and upper leg lifts: superb contour, slower mark maturation Skin excision on the arms and internal upper legs transforms suit apparel. It likewise develops long marks in locations with movement and friction. Healing assumptions: First 2 weeks: swelling and stiffness limit range of movement. Arms choose T-rex motion awhile. Upper legs dislike long strolls because of chafing and tension. Weeks 3 to eight: function returns. Discoloration solves. Marks look thick and red, after that gradually quiet. It's simple to exaggerate it here and tug the cut. Most modifications for widened marks occur due to the fact that task increase as well fast. Months 3 to 6: shape clears up. Scar massage therapy, silicone, and sun security pay dividends. Twelve months: final scar look. Some individuals choose laser sessions at 3 to 6 months to relax soreness or texture. Non-surgical body sculpting: very little downtime, advancing change Non-invasive therapies request for less from your schedule and even more from your perseverance. They push cells to transform with chilly, heat, power, or neuromuscular excitement. Outcomes integrate in layers. Cryolipolysis: peaceful fat decrease over weeks Cryolipolysis, usually called fat cold, targets pinchable pockets. One cycle deals with a solitary applicator area, and many strategies make use of 2 to 6 cycles across a session. Expect: Zero to three days: light discomfort, tingling, or prickling. Some people have no downtime at all. Weeks two to four: a "who moved my fat?" moment seldom arrives yet. Early adjustments are refined or invisible. Weeks six to eight: fat layer programs reduction. Garments fit a bit easier. If you contrast photos, you see it. Twelve weeks: optimal decrease per cycle, usually 20 to 25 percent in the treated fat layer. If you require more, stack an additional session at the 6 to eight-week mark and court at the three-month point. Numbness can last longer than individuals expect, sometimes as much as six to eight weeks. That is typical, extra an odd feeling than a problem. Do not utilize heating pads to "speed up recovery." They do not help and can shed numb skin. Radiofrequency and ultrasound gadgets: heat-driven tightening These systems warm up the dermis or much deeper cells to boost collagen and decrease laxity. They beam when skin requires a push but not a scalpel. Immediately after: moderate redness and heat for a couple of hours. One to two weeks: most really feel no downtime. Improvements are incremental. Early collagen tightening tightens slightly, after that new collagen production builds. Eight to twelve weeks: visible tightening arises. For mild crepey skin on the abdominal area or above knees, this is the factor it looks worth it. Three to six months: peak impact. Upkeep sessions one or two times a year maintain the gains. The sincere catch: heat-based tightening does not replace surgical treatment when there is substantial excess or stretched, harmed dermis. It can polish, not remodel an entire room. Electromagnetic toning: reinforcing under the surface High-intensity focused electro-magnetic (HIFEM) devices create solid, spontaneous muscle contractions. They enhance and hypertrophy muscular tissue, which assists definition. Good expectations: Zero downtime, but the dealt with muscle mass group can feel happily wrecked for a day. Four sessions over two weeks prevails. Noticeable tone by week 3 to 4. Height at 2 to 3 months. Works best when paired with fat decrease, either from your own routines or another modality. Muscular tissues develop, however fat density over them hides definition. Injectable enzymes or deoxycholic acid for tiny pockets Submental fat under the chin is the classic target. Anticipate swelling that runs out percentage to the injection quantity for the first week. You look even worse prior to you look much better, then much better than before by week 4 to six. What reasonable looks like by procedure Sometimes numbers assure much better than adjectives. Based upon normal situations and a few thousand follow-ups: Small-area liposuction surgery, such as submental or upper abdomen: most individuals feel work-ready in two to three days, light exercise by day 5 to 7, and see 80 percent of the final result by 4 to 6 weeks, 100 percent by three months. Multi-area liposuction surgery, like abdominal area, flanks, and back: workdesk work at seven to ten days, light exercises by 2 weeks, noticeable shaping by 4 weeks, last look at 4 to 6 months. Abdominoplasty with fixing and flank lipo: workdesk job at 2 to 3 weeks, driving once off narcotics and pain allows turning, normally day seven to 10, core exercise phased in after 8 weeks, 80 percent of outcome by 8 to ten weeks, full growth by six to twelve months. Arm lift: work at 7 to 10 days if non-physical, overhanging training deferred for four to six weeks, scar growth approximately a year. Thigh lift: walking is great and encouraged, but long walks wait two to three weeks, fitness center work returns in stages over 6 weeks, scars require time and perseverance as a result of friction. Cryolipolysis: no downtime, results at six to twelve weeks per round, usually 2 rounds required for finest result on stubborn bulges. RF skin tightening: no downtime, layered renovations that crest at three to 6 months. HIFEM toning: no downtime, noticeable tone by one month, ideal at two to three, upkeep monthly or quarterly if you wish to hold the line. Cryolipolysis: the classic fridge freezer still gains its place If body contouring had a hall of popularity, cryolipolysis would remain in the first class. It continues to be the most identified therapy for local lumps. The principle is delightfully basic. Fat cells are vulnerable to cool. Awesome them to the best temperature level for long enough and they undertake apoptosis, after that the body removes them out over 2 to 3 months. Real-world notes from the treatment area: suction applicators fit convex protrudes ideal. Soft, scattered fat that spreads out like a quilt commonly requires more recent, flatter applicators or a different modality. People with a limited, athletic abdominal area however a little pinch at the lower tummy succeed. Clients with a huge, strong tummy or substantial diastasis recti leave underwhelmed. Common side effects consist of temporary tingling, prickling, wounding, and swelling. The majority of people go back to function the very same day. The unusual difficulty everyone murmurs about, paradoxical adipose hyperplasia, looks like a firm augmentation that slowly grows over months. I have actually seen it twice in a decade throughout many cycles, which matches the reduced incidence reported in literature. It is fixable, typically with liposuction, however nobody desires that detour. Device option, correct strategy, and traditional settings on new patients help maintain the chances in your favor. Where it radiates: flanks, upper abdomen in the ideal prospect, banana roll under the buttock, upper arms if cells is pinchable, inner upper legs. Where it has a hard time: lower abdomen with skin laxity, irregular fat pads on extremely lean people, areas with ruptures or jeopardized sensation. Radiofrequency: not just for faces anymore Radiofrequency treatments fall into two camps. Thermal RF warms the dermis and subcutaneous layer to stimulate collagen, elastin, and often adipocyte injury. RF microneedling uses shielded or semi-insulated needles to deliver power straight into the dermis, exceptional for tightening up and texture. For body contouring, monopolar RF gets to much deeper than bipolar, that makes it useful for light to moderate laxity. Abdomen after pregnancy? Arms that flap when you wave? Knees that resemble they have opinions? Good targets. When incorporated with suction massage therapy or in-motion distribution, RF can likewise smooth cellulite by boosting dermal thickness and septal remodeling. The experience is generally a steady warmth that can reach cozy degrees. Professionals need to relocate with method and usage real-time temperature level surveillance. Great sessions tease with 42 to 45 ° C at the skin surface, held enough time to set off renovating without going across right into burn territory. Sessions generally run in collection, such as three to six spaced every one to four weeks. Where it beams: skin laxity on the abdomen, post-liposuction ripple smoothing, arms, upper legs, knees, and as a pairing with fat decrease to stay clear of the deflated appearance. Where it struggles: thick, coarse fat pads that require apoptosis rather than collagen pep talks. High-intensity electro-magnetic muscular tissue excitement: devices that out-crunch you HIFEM and associated technologies supply supramaximal contractions, much beyond what voluntary exercise achieves in a brief home window. An abdominal area session may generate 10s of countless tightenings in under a half hour. The feeling is strange in the beginning, like a really determined fitness instructor tapping your muscles from the within. You get utilized to it by minute five, or you stare at the ceiling and question if you flossed enough this year. The goal is twofold. Initially, hypertrophy and in some cases hyperplasia of muscle fibers, which translates to better tone and enhanced thickness on imaging. Second, additional fat reduction from metabolic demand. On uncomplicated abdominal areas, I commonly see waists tighten by a few centimeters after a collection of four to six sessions spaced two to 5 days apart. Glutes raise discreetly without the fitness center mass fear that keeps some people on the treadmill permanently. Calves and arms are feasible however require mindful candidateship to avoid cramps. The constraints are similarly clear. If you have a much deeper fat layer on the abdominal area, the muscle acquires hide under the blanket. Couple with a fat reduction technique first, after that utilize HIFEM. Clients with steel implants in the treatment field, pacemakers, or specific ruptures are not candidates. Ultrasound: concentrated precision and gentle sweeps Ultrasound is available in tastes. High-intensity concentrated ultrasound can target a layer of fat at controlled midsts, developing small coagulation zones that the body removes. It is much more operator dependent and frequently a lot more uneasy without numbing, but the precision is satisfying for small, defined pockets like a reduced stomach shelf or a bit above the knees. Medium-depth, in-motion ultrasound blends thermal and mechanical impacts to warmth subcutaneous tissue extra extensively. It offers smoother, progressive decrease with much less discomfort. In practiced hands, it can refine areas that cryolipolysis can't grab. Side effects have a tendency to be mild pain and periodic bruising. Select carriers that map midsts based on pinch density and who comprehend how ultrasound connects with capillary and nerves because area. The factor of precision is accuracy, not adventure. Low-level laser and shot lipolysis: supportive duties with particular use cases Low-level laser therapy nudges fat cells to launch lipids without killing them. By itself, changes are softer and more reliant on your caloric equilibrium. I utilize it as a complement to speed up lymphatic clearance after various other fat reduction or when a client desires the gentlest touch and comprehends the trade-off. Injection lipolysis uses deoxycholic acid and comparable representatives to dissolve fat. The FDA-cleared area remains under the chin, where it performs well for the appropriate submental pad. Off-label body usage exists, yet side effects like swelling and pain range up swiftly. For tiny pockets that do not fit an applicator or a portable device, a careful approach with tiny volumes can function, yet the bar for patient option and permission must be high. Fat 101: exactly how adipose tissue behaves Adipose tissue shops energy inside fat cells, or adipocytes. You gain or shed fat mass mainly by changing the quantity of these cells, not their number. Adolescence and significant weight shifts can boost cell number, however in adulthood, you primarily have actually a repaired supply. That matters since body sculpting's fat-reduction approaches reduce the variety of cells in a treated area. Less cells indicates much less capacity to save fat there in the future, although the staying cells can still increase the size of if you regularly consume beyond your needs. The various other useful information: fat cells are more vulnerable than surrounding structures, specifically when exposed to cool, warmth, or mechanical tension. That vulnerability is the bar these treatments pull. Cryolipolysis: regulated cold and discerning injury Cryolipolysis looks deceptively basic. You apply a vacuum cleaner cup that draws cells into an applicator, after that cool down the area to a slim, subzero range that harms fat cells greater than skin, nerves, or muscular tissue. Fat's lipid material makes adipocytes crystallize at warmer temperatures than water-rich cells, so the fat cells take the hit. Over the next several weeks, macrophages scoop the harmed cells. You don't pee out liquefied fat right now; you gradually clear cellular debris in the same quiet, average means your body tidies up a bruise. In the center, the work remains in the fit. Applicator shape and setting, overlap patterns, and suction degree issue. I have actually seen outcomes go from respectable to exceptional just by turning an applicator 10 degrees so it catches the complete lump rather than skimming the peak. A solitary cycle normally reduces the pinchable fat layer by roughly 15 to 25 percent in that zone, with noticeable change showing up in 6 to 12 weeks. Delicate locations like the top abdomen or banana roll need perseverance and precise placement. Side impacts range from pins and needles and ache to transient firmness, which generally resolve within days to weeks. An uncommon issue, paradoxical adipose hyperplasia, triggers the area to increase the size of instead of reduce. It's unusual, but it's the reason a service provider will certainly screen you very carefully and map your composition rather than rushing to treat every square inch. Cryolipolysis plays best with distinct, distinct bulges: lower abdomen, flanks, internal upper legs, submental location. It is much less practical on firm visceral fat put under the stomach wall surface. If you can't squeeze it, you can not ice up it. Heat as a sculpting tool: radiofrequency, ultrasound, and laser While cold injures fat cells through condensation, heat damages them via denaturation and apoptosis, the controlled cell death that adheres to cellular stress and anxiety. The technique is to obtain the energy where you need it without burning the skin. Three strategies dominate. Radiofrequency functions like attentively applied rubbing. Alternating existing circulations via tissue and produces heat symmetrical to resistance. Some tools rely upon mass heating between surface electrodes, others use microneedles to provide energy directly into the fat or dermis. For fat decrease, the goal is to bring the subcutaneous layer right into the 42 to 47 Celsius array enough time to activate adipocyte apoptosis without blistering. For skin tightening up, energy is focused in the dermis to boost fibroblasts and redesign collagen. Ultrasound splits right into diagnostic and restorative camps, and we only appreciate the latter. High-intensity focused ultrasound assembles sound waves into limited centerpieces under the skin, creating microthermal coagulation areas at targeted midsts. Think about each prime focus as a speck of controlled injury. The body's wound-repair response sets brand-new collagen and elastin, and the cumulative impact is a tightening and lifting of the cured location. Some systems intend ultrasound at the fat layer to interfere with adipocytes; others target the fibromuscular airplane for raising along the jawline or brow. Laser lipolysis utilizes particular wavelengths soaked up by fat and water to heat cells selectively. In noninvasive kind, energy is pulsed with the skin while cooling down secures the surface area. In minimally intrusive versions, a slim fiber passes under the skin to thaw fat straight, commonly incorporated with suction. Finest practices count on real-time temperature level comments to remain in the therapeutic window. Providers typically blend these powers over a collection of sessions, utilizing heat to soften fibrous bands, reduce superficial fat, and tone the overlying skin. The art lies in choosing the right deepness and pattern. The science supports the settings: time, temperature level, and cells conductivity dictate effect. The partner of the picture: collagen, elastin, and why skin sags If fat reduction is reduction, skin firm is modifying the staying fabric so it lies smoothly. Skin changes with age and stretch for two main factors: collagen fibers lose thickness and organization, and elastin fibers come to be fragmented. Collagen provides skin tensile strength, elastin offers it breeze. Hormonal agents, UV direct exposure, and mechanical stress all speed the unraveling. When you heat dermal cells to a specific array, you cause immediate collagen tightening and set off a longer improvement response. Fibroblasts wake up, increase collagen synthesis, and over three to 6 months, the dermis enlarges and straightens. That is why tightening up therapies hardly ever deliver a full effect promptly; they are asking biology to do carpentry.
